#E85CFE Hex Color Code

#E85CFE

The Hexadecimal Color #E85CFE is a contrast shade of Violet. #E85CFE RGB value is rgb(232, 92, 254). RGB Color Model of #E85CFE consists of 90% red, 36% green and 99% blue. HSL color Mode of #E85CFE has 292°(degrees) Hue, 99% Saturation and 68% Lightness. #E85CFE color has an wavelength of 436.14815n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#E85CFE is #FF66F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#E85CFE is #E5F. The Closest Color to #E85CFE is #EE82EE. Official Name of #E85CFE Hex Code is Heliotrope.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#E85CFE is 9 Cyan 64 Magenta 0 Yellow 0 Black and #E85CFE CMY is 9, 64,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#E85CFE is hsl(292,99,68,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(292, 64, 100).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#E85CFE is 54.99, 31.97, 97.02.
Hex8 Value of #E85CFE is #E85CFEFF. Decimal Value of #E85CFE is 15228158 and Octal Value of #E85CFE is 72056376. Binary Value of #E85CFE is 11101000, 1011100, 11111110 and Android of #E85CFE is 4293418238 / 0xffe85cfe.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#E85CFE is 0.299, 0.174, 0.174 and YIQ Color Space of #E85CFE is 152.328, 31.3754, 80.0244.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#E85CFE is 38.27, 16.17, 96.01.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#E85CFE is 63.32, 74.74, -55.7.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#E85CFE is 63.32, 56.46, -98.65.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#E85CFE is 63.32, 93.21, 323.3. Hunter Lab variable of #E85CFE is 56.54, 74.65, -62.16.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#E85CFE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
